Native War Paints 'Battle of Scarif'

Hello! For todays post I have a look at a fabulous green from Native War Paints, 'Battle of Scarif'. This was originally part of a Star Wars light side duo in collaboration with Bluebird Lacquer. I managed to pick up the Native War Paints half Polish Con in Chicago, and I'm pretty sure it was only $5 too - bargain! Read on for my swatch and more info.

Native War Paints 'Battle of Scarif' @acertainbeccaa

'Battle of Scarif' is a bright green base with a strong golden/copper shimmer. It does start off a bit sheer, but the formula is smooth and easy to apply, and covers evenly. I did need a third coat to cover my nail line, but those with shorter nails should be fine in two. This dries down fairly matte which I actually quite like. Below is three coats without topcoat.
